Let \(\mathbb{N}_0\) be the set of non-negative integers and let \(A\) be the Fomin-Kirillov algebra on three generators over a field \(k\) of characteristic different from 2 and 3. In a previous work [\textit{E. Herscovich} and \textit{Z. Li}, ``Hochschild and cyclic (co)homology of the Fomin-Kirillov algebra on 3 generators'', Preprint, \url{arXiv:2112.01201}] the authors have computed the graded commutative algebra structure of Hochschild cohomology of \(A\), denoted by \(\mathrm{HH}^{\ast}(A)\), and showed that \(\mathrm{HH}^{\ast}(A)\) has non-zero generators only in degree zero, one, two, three and four. In this article the authors compute the Gerstenhaber bracket of \(\mathrm{HH}^{\ast}(A)\). In order to carry these calculations they consider different cases. Firstly, they develop a method which allows to compute the bracket between elements of \(\mathrm{HH}^0(A)\) and elements of \(\mathrm{HH}^n(A)\), where \(n\in \mathbb{N}_0\). Such method holds not only for the Fomin-Kirillov algebra of dimension 12 but for any algebra. In order to compute, for any \(n \in \mathbb{N}_0\), the bracket between the elements of \(\mathrm{HH}^n(A)\) and the elements of \(\mathrm{HH}^1(A)\) they employ the method introduced in [\textit{M. Suarez-Alvarez}, J. Pure Appl. Algebra 221, No. 8, 1981--1998 (2017; Zbl 1392.16009)]. For the remaining calculations they prove a result that applies in the particular case of \(A\). The article also includes a proof showing that the Gerstenhaber bracket of \(\mathrm{HH}^{\ast}(A)\) is not induced by any Batalin-Vilkovisky generator.
